A ‘zonal commander’ of the People’s Liberation Front of India (PLFI), a splinter group of the Communist Party of India-Maoist (CPI-Maoist), identified as Ajay Oraon (29), from Jharkhand was arrested from a migrant labour camp in Kaimbalam area under Pantheerankavu Police Station limits in Kozhikode District of Kerala on April 18, in a joint Kerala and Jharkhand Police operation, reports The Times of India. Oraon had been living at the migrant labour camp in Kaimbalam area in the guise of a construction worker for the last one month. According to Police, Oraon is wanted in connection with conspiracy related to the burning of several vehicles of a road contractor after trying to extort money from him in Jharkhand in March 2023. It is alleged that though Oraon was in Kerala when the attack took place, he was involved in its conspiracy.
